How much do you invest and what does Joystick Labs get in return?
It depends on the team size; $6,000 per founder, or up to $18,000 seed funding per team. We also get a modest equity stake in your company in exchange for funding it, and a share of the money generated by the game or app you work on at Joystick Labs.
What if we need more than $18,000 to make our game?
Then you may be able to use your time and resources at Joystick Labs to make a killer proof-of-concept and use that to attract further investment.
Do we need to write a business plan? Design doc? Submit a demo?
Probably not a business plan; just start with our application form here. If you have a design doc, that's great, but not strictly necessary. A demo, however, is highly encouraged. We're looking for talented folks who can deliver on their vision given some time and resources; a demo shows us these qualities in a very direct way.
Will you fund a company with only one founder?
Only if you are capable of making your game or app by yourself. Teams of 2-5 are strongly encouraged.
